Ah, Doha in winter! A shimmering mirage of luxury, history, and untold stories, perfectly suited for our discerning six travelers. Prepare yourselves for an adventure that blends opulence with intrigue, as we delve into the heart of Qatari culture.

Accommodation: Forget standard hotels; we're talking about the crème de la crème. The Four Seasons Hotel Doha, the Ritz-Carlton, Doha, and the Mandarin Oriental, Doha offer unparalleled service and breathtaking views. For a more private experience, consider opulent villas available through various luxury concierge services. Expect to pay upwards of $1,000 per night for a top-tier hotel room or a similar amount for a luxurious villa rental.

High-End Shopping and Dining: The Villaggio Mall, with its Venetian-inspired canals, offers designer boutiques, while the Place Vendôme showcases high-end luxury brands. Dining experiences range from Michelin-recommended restaurants like Nobu and IDDO to exquisite traditional Qatari fare. Budget around $500-$1,000 per couple per day for dining and shopping.

Private Transportation and Exclusive Tours: Private chauffeured cars are readily available, costing roughly $100-$200 per day. Exclusive tours can be arranged through luxury travel agencies, encompassing desert safaris, falconry demonstrations, and private museum visits. Factor in $2,000-$3,000 for a curated itinerary of private tours for the group.

Climate and Weather: Winter in Doha (November to April) boasts pleasant temperatures, ideal for outdoor activities. Expect daytime highs in the 70s°F (20s°C) and cooler evenings.

Crowd Levels: While Doha is becoming increasingly popular, winter offers a less crowded experience than the summer months. The potential for a more secluded experience is very real if your itinerary is planned accordingly.

Upscale Spas and Wellness: Luxury hotels and resorts boast world-class spas offering traditional treatments and modern therapies. Expect to pay $200-$400 per couple for a spa day.

Unique and Personalized Experiences: Imagine a private dhow cruise under the stars, a falconry lesson with an expert, or a curated art tour of local galleries – Doha offers endless possibilities for bespoke experiences. The cost will vary greatly depending on the activity, but budget an additional $1,000-$2,000 for unique experiences.

Security and Safety: Doha is known for its high level of safety and security, particularly for affluent travelers. The city is extremely secure.

Local Culture: Experience the vibrant souks (markets), savor traditional Qatari cuisine like machboos (spiced meat and rice), and observe the graceful elegance of local dress. The atmosphere is generally relaxed and welcoming, with a blend of local Qatari residents and international visitors. The sounds of the city are a mix of modern urban life and traditional Middle Eastern melodies. Palm trees and other desert-adapted plants thrive in the landscape.

Estimated Total Cost: Based on the estimations above, a luxurious winter trip to Doha for three couples could range from $15,000 to $25,000, depending on your choices and preferences. Remember, this is a guideline, and costs can be adjusted to fit your budget.

Important Note: These cost estimations are approximate. Actual prices may vary depending on the season, availability, and your specific choices. Always confirm prices with providers before booking.

Essential Doha, Qatar Insights: What You Need to Know

Doha, the vibrant capital of Qatar, offers a fascinating blend of ancient traditions and futuristic ambition. When planning your visit, it's important to be aware of a few key aspects to make your experience as smooth and enjoyable as possible. Respecting local customs and dress codes is paramount; while Doha is increasingly cosmopolitan, modest attire, especially when visiting religious sites or more traditional areas, is highly appreciated. Understanding the daily prayer times is also beneficial, as some businesses may temporarily close. The local currency is the Qatari Riyal (QAR), and credit cards are widely accepted in most establishments, but carrying some cash for smaller purchases is a good idea.

Navigating Doha is generally straightforward. The public transportation system is developing, with the Doha Metro offering a convenient and efficient way to explore many key areas. Taxis are readily available and often metered, but it's always wise to confirm the fare or ensure the meter is used. For those seeking cultural immersion, the Museum of Islamic Art and the Souq Waqif are must-visit destinations, offering a glimpse into Qatar's rich heritage. When it comes to dining, Doha boasts an incredible array of culinary experiences, from traditional Qatari cuisine to international fine dining. Don't miss the opportunity to try Machboos, a flavorful rice dish often considered a national staple.

Staying hydrated is crucial, especially during the warmer months. Tap water is generally safe to drink, but many visitors opt for bottled water for added peace of mind. The official language is Arabic, but English is widely spoken, particularly in tourist areas, hotels, and major businesses. Tipping is not mandatory but is appreciated for good service, with 10-15% being a common guideline in restaurants and for hotel staff. Finally, be prepared for the climate; Doha experiences hot and humid summers and mild winters. Pack accordingly, with light, breathable clothing being essential for much of the year.
